## Authentication

The Brindlecart load-test suite simulates checkout traffic against the staging gateway. Each virtual user session must authenticate before adding items to the cart; unauthenticated runs will return 401s and skew the latency numbers. The harness reads a shared token at startup and injects it into every request header. Use the token below when reproducing a run locally.

portal login ticket: eyJhbGciOiJIUzI1NiIsInR5cCI6IkpXVCJ9.eyJzdWIiOiIMjvRAf3PEFIn0.nuv9gjixLtnr

### Runbook: Account Recovery — Build Agent Clock Skew

When Dovetail build agents drift more than 90 seconds, signed auth tokens are rejected and the pipeline account locks. Resync NTP on each agent, then restart the token broker. If the account remains locked after resync, recover it through the Dovetail admin shell. The recovery step prompts for the passphrase shown below.

recovery phrase for bawef-haduf: wenax-druox-julmir

TICKET: Config drift on PulseGate chip readers

Field units at the Harrowfen Marathon report reads dropping after 30km. Root cause: readers flashed last month kept old antenna gain and dedupe-window settings. Plugin authors: do not hardcode these values. Drift between your plugin assumptions and reader config causes duplicate splits. Readers will be reflashed tonight. Validate your plugins against the canonical settings. The correct baseline config follows.

deployment values, kajep-kageg:
[praix]
host = praix.paliqcorp.corp
user = praix_svc
database = praix_prod

## Further reading

The Emberledger service records every loyalty-points accrual and redemption as an append-only entry; balances are always derived, never stored. Before touching reconciliation code, read the ledger invariants doc and the idempotency notes — most past bugs came from violating one of those. For this week's sync, the design overview and open questions are collected on the internal page here.

runbook for badug-kadup: https://confluence.zemvarlabs.internal/projects/browse/display/projects/bd1b